<p>Alphawave Semi is sampling its portfolio of optoelectronics products targeting the high-speed interconnect semiconductor market, expected to exceed $4 billion by 2028. The portfolio includes DSPs for PAM4 and emerging Coherent-lite modulation, using PAM4 SerDes with its WidEye DSP architecture and EyeQ diagnostic technology. The 800G and 1.6T interconnect products support up to 20km optical reach based on PAM4 and Coherent-lite solutions.</p>
